解释这段代码的作用和流程 if(ver_item->valueint != 0) { cat_file_name(def_cmd,sizeof(def_cmd),para_profile.param_rofile_dir,MISC_DEF_CONF_FILE_PATH); if(0!=configure_parse(conf_def, NULL, def_cmd)) { return -1; } if(0!=configure_parse(conf_cur, NULL, def_cmd)) { } } else { cat_file_name(def_cmd,sizeof(def_cmd),para_profile.param_rofile_dir,MISC_DEF_FILE_PATH); fix_old_misc_def_cur_conf(def_cmd,1); fix_old_misc_def_cur_conf(def_cmd,0); }
时间: 2023-03-30 07:00:20 浏览: 123
XMC_Ebike-ver2.0.2(2018.05.30规范后).rar_XMC_Ebike-ver2.0.2_ebike_x
5星 · 资源好评率100%
这段代码的作用是根据一个变量(ver_item)的值来选择不同的配置文件进行解析。如果变量(ver_item)的值不为,则使用默认的配置文件路径(MISC_DEF_CONF_FILE_PATH)来解析配置文件(conf_def和conf_cur)。如果变量(ver_item)的值为,则使用另一个默认的配置文件路径(MISC_DEF_FILE_PATH)来解析配置文件,并且还会调用fix_old_misc_def_cur_conf函数来修复旧的配置文件。
阅读全文